Observational Features and Databases of Solar Cosmic Rays,ations. At the turn of the 1990s (Simpson 1990; Shea and Smart 1993a; see also Cliver 2009), an international name “GLE” (Ground Level Enhancement or Ground Level Event) was assigned to ground level increases or enhancements of SCR intensity.
